ABOUT THE RETREAT
Tantra is a provocative and often misunderstood word which, in Buddhism, describes the transformational abilities of the body and mind to use energies and emotions that would otherwise be problematic. Dive into the profound psychology of tantra and see what resonates for you. There will be a public talk on Friday evening that will include time for questions as an introductory to tantric meditation. The following two days will consist of applying the teachings from Intro to Tantra into practice with a Chenrezig Practice Weekend for Wisdom and Compassion.
This mini retreat will use Chenrezig sadhanas as the basis for in depth meditations to deepen our wisdom and compassion. The practice includes prayer recitation, chanting, mantra and visualization as well as some analytical meditation. The retreat itself will include explanation of the practice and time for questions as well as personal break time practices to enrich your daily life experience of Chenrezig. ABOUT THE TEACHER
Bhikshuni Lozang Yönten is an American-born Buddhist nun in the Tibetan tradition who was ordained in 2003. A practicing Buddhist since 1994, Venerable Yönten moved to Chenrezig Institute in Australia and studied intensively under Khensur Rinpoche Geshe Tashi Tsering (Lharampa Geshe from Sera Je Monastery and former Abbot of Gyü-me Tanric College) from 2002 – 2009, completing their Buddhist Studies Program. She then continued to study, retreat and offer service at Dharma Centers in India and Taiwan as well as Australia and New Zealand, becoming an In-Depth Registered Teacher within the Foundation for the Preservation of the Mahayana Tradition (FPMT) in 2012.
Ven. Yönten was the Resident Teacher of Kunsang Yeshe Retreat Centre in the Blue Mountains of Australia from 2012 – 2015 before becoming teacher-in-residence six months of the year at Mahamudra Centre for Universal Unity in New Zealand until 2018. She has just arrived to Land of Medicine Buddha to be one of our resident teachers for six months out of the year, to allow her to honor her other teaching engagements worldwide.
Currently, Ven. Yönten divides her time as a touring teacher and retreat leader, as well as annually offering the Buddhadharma from a secular perspective in Israel as a member of the Buddhist faculty for a seven-year post graduate program called Human Spirit which is a Buddhist Psychoanalytic Training Program.
